Biblical Wisdom on Resolving Marital Conflicts
1. Ephesians 4:26-27
“Be angry and do not sin; do not let the sun go down on your anger, and give no opportunity to the devil.”
2. Proverbs 15:1
“A soft answer turns away wrath, but a harsh word stirs up anger.”
3. Colossians 3:13
“Bearing with one another and, if one has a complaint against another, forgiving each other; as the Lord has forgiven you, so you also must forgive.”
4. Proverbs 17:14
“The beginning of strife is like letting out water, so quit before the quarrel breaks out.”
5. Matthew 5:9
“Blessed are the peacemakers, for they shall be called sons of God.”
6. James 1:19-20
“Know this, my beloved brothers: let every person be quick to hear, slow to speak, slow to anger; for the anger of man does not produce the righteousness of God.”
7. Proverbs 18:13
“If one gives an answer before he hears, it is his folly and shame.”
8. Philippians 2:3-4
“Do nothing from selfish ambition or conceit, but in humility count others more significant than yourselves. Let each of you look not only to his own interests, but also to the interests of others.”
9. Proverbs 30:33
“For pressing milk produces curds, pressing the nose produces blood, and pressing anger produces strife.”
